Take hold of a premium seat-- there are additional of them.Business fliers whose spending limitations enable upgrades have an expanding number of opportunities to run away coach class. That's because providers-- which recognize deep-pocketed business travelers boost margins-- have been increasing their service and costs economic situation seat matters, specifically on trans- as well as global courses. American Airlines, specifically, has been investing in high end offerings that CEO Robert Isom phones "some of the vivid areas" of the business. Secret to that investment are its anticipated Front runner Suites, which are going to feature moving doors for optimum personal privacy together with lie-flat chairs and also unique service sets. These collections will certainly debut on new long-haul, mostly worldwide plane, and also will certainly switch out United States's Crown jewel First chairs on older aircrafts. The suites will certainly be participated in through brand new luxe, recliner-style premium economic situation chairs along with wireless charging. The airline company assumes to debut both the sets and also the premium economic climate seats later on this year.-- David Salazar2. Airline lounges are actually terrific. Credit card lobbies are upcoming level.As American Express, Hunt, and also Resources One battle to capture high-spending cardholders through piling on travel rewards, their airport bars-- along with worker-friendly basics and premium features-- are ending up being locations unto on their own. AmEx leads the pack along with its 29 Centurion Lounges worldwide (and access to another 1,400-plus others) that level to Platinum Memory card (yearly expense $695) holders. Its most current opened at Reagan National Flight Terminal (DCA) in July and also consists of a tropical drink pub, workstations, as well as shower set, in addition to original art from D.C.-based performers. Hunt's Sapphire Reserve Card (annual cost $550) uses accessibility to Top priority Successfully pass's 1,500 bars, plus four trademark Pursuit Sapphire Lounges. The most recent, in The big apple's LaGuardia, even offers three luxe Get Suites (coming from $2,200 for three hrs) with curated menus as well as personal washrooms as well as showers. It's all aspect of an attempt to "completely re-envision" the airport terminal take in, claims Chase's Dana Pouwels, who leads the bank's flight terminal cocktail lounge benefits. Funds One works 3 bars for Endeavor X cardholders (yearly fee $395) as well as forthcoming, food-focused "touchdowns" at DCA and LGA with menus produced along with Josu00e9 Andru00e9s Group.
